How they compare
Vanuatu currently reports 3.3% against 2.9% in Barbados, a difference of 0.4%.
That makes Vanuatu's figure about 1.2 times Barbados's.
Across all 26 years both countries report, Vanuatu has been ahead every year.
Barbados ranks 162nd and Vanuatu ranks 159th of 177 countries.
Vanuatu has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
